EDH (Elder Dragon Highlander)

EDH in manalink is an approximation of the paper version of Elder Dragon Highlander.
Warning: You must unlock the 'Enter the Dragon' challenge in challenge set 4 before you can play EDH.
Rules:
Your deck must be exactly 105 cards, with no duplicates other than basic land (this rule is not enforced by the game engine).
1 of those 105 cards must be the EDH card, and there must be 5 copies of your General in there.Total number of cards 105.
Your general is any Legendary creature. Cards in your deck MUST share colors with your General. For example, if your General is Nicol Bolas, you may use Red, Blue, and Black cards in any combination. So no Llanowar Elf (green), Death Grasp (white), or Stalker Hag (green hybrid).
You start at 40 life. If you take 21 points of damage from your opponent's general, you lose.
Whenever you could play a creature, you can active the EDH card to put a copy of your general into play by paying its mana cost. The next time you use this ability it will cost 2 additional mana.
You get 1 free mulligan
Additional mana is represented on the EDH card by tombstones. Damage dealt by your general is represented by +1/+1 counters on the EDH card.
